Special events at Dharma Yoga Studio

The Dharma Yoga Studio has a few special events coming up.

On Friday, October 29, from 7 to 8:30 pm, there's Funyasa Yoga with Natalie Morales with live sacred music by Richard Brookens.

Cost is $20 in advance, $25 at the door.

On October 31, awaken your inner athlete with Power Bake with Cat Haayen. This transformational immersion harmonizes breathing and action. Cat is the creator of Yogatleta. She'll safely clear obstacles to your physical freedom Her program is designed to therapeutically heat, tone and purify the entire body -- it's called Vinysas Chikitsa, or breath-motion therapy.


This is $25 in advance and $30 at the door. It is from 1:30 to 4 pm.

Dharma Studio is at 3170 Commodore Plaza. For more info or to sign up for the classes, please call 305-461-1777.

Then on Monday, November 1, a new meditation series, “Inner Science,” will start at Dharma Studio. The eight-week series will be held Monday evenings from 7:45 to 9:15 pm.

The classes in this series present scientific methods for improving human nature and qualities through developing the capacity of the mind. By learning how to use this simple inner technology, it can greatly increase happiness and quality of life. The series is based on the new book, Modern Buddhism, by Geshe Kelsang Gyatso. The classes are taught by American Buddhist monk Kelsang Norbu. Although part of a series, each class is self-contained. Everyone is welcome.
